King fish tacos

INGREDIENTS

Boneless King Fish - 8 oz (cubed)

Salt - to taste

Black Pepper - to taste

Green Seasoning - 1/8 cup

Minced Chadon Beni/Culantro - 1/8 cup

Minced Garlic - 1 tbsp

Minced Ginger - 1 tbsp

Vegetable Oil - 3 cups

Soft Taco Shells - 3

Hard Taco Shells - 3

Kraft Mexican Style Four Cheese - 1 (8oz) pack

Tomato Salsa - 1/2 cup Sour Cream - 1/4 cup

METHOD

1. Wash, clean and pat dry king fish

2. Season with salt, black pepper, green seasoning, chadon beni, garlic and ginger

3. Let marinate for 4 to 6 hours or overnight

4. Heat vegetable oil over high heat to 350 degrees Fahrenheit

5. Coat king fish in flour and fry until golden brown and crispy

6. Set aside, allowing excess oil to drain

7. Heat a frying pan over low to medium heat

8. Add soft shell taco

9. Sprinkle a little cheese on taco shell and allow to melt

10. Once melted, top with hard shell taco as illustrated in the video. You want the soft shell taco to stick to the hard shell

11. Now it’s time to fill your shells

12. Start with a layer of cheese, then fish, tomato salsa, sour cream and top with more cheese

13. Enjoy!
